GNOME Bugzilla – Bug 391331
aisleriot crashes on exit
Last modified: 2012-01-31 23:23:16 UTC
Steps to reproduce: 1. Win aisleriot 2. at dialog box, choose quit instead of new game 3. bug buddy launches and makes report with no debuginfo 4. look at old report and file bug report at distribution level. Reference: https://bugzilla.redhat.com/bugzilla/show_bug.cgi?id=221046 5. install debuginfo package and try to see if repeatable. 6. win game and find error is repeatable. 7. add to distro report and enter bug at upstream level, Stack trace: System: Linux 2.6.19-1.2891.fc7 #1 SMP Thu Dec 21 10:59:07 EST 2006 i686 X Vendor: The X.Org Foundation X Vendor Release: 70101000 Selinux: No Accessibility: Enabled Memory status: size: 56164352 vsize: 0 resident: 56164352 share: 0 rss: 23695360 rss_rlim: 0 CPU usage: start_time: 1167578672 rtime: 0 utime: 841 stime: 0 cutime:673 cstime: 0 timeout: 168 it_real_value: 0 frequency: 0 Backtrace was generated from '/usr/libexec/aisleriot' Using host libthread_db library "/lib/libthread_db.so.1". [Thread debugging using libthread_db enabled] [New Thread -1208969520 (LWP 3558)] 0x00ede402 in __kernel_vsyscall ()
+ Trace 98296
Thread 1 (Thread -1208969520 (LWP 3558))
----------- .xsession-errors --------------------- (evolution:3491): GLib-GObject-WARNING **: IA__g_object_weak_unref: couldn't find weak ref 0x1ad870(0x9f30390) addressbook_migrate (2.8.0) GTK Accessibility Module initialized Bonobo accessibility support initialized Some deprecated features have been used. Set the environment variable GUILE_WARN_DEPRECATED to "detailed" and rerun the program to get more information. Set it to "no" to suppress this message. GTK Accessibility Module initialized Bonobo accessibility support initialized GTK Accessibility Module initialized Bonobo accessibility support initialized /usr/libexec/aisleriot: No such file or directory. -------------------------------------------------- Other information: This is running development version of Fedora Core. kernel-2.6.19-1.2890.fc7
Created attachment 79127 [details] added ORBit2-debuginfo for more information Played again after adding ORBit2-debuginfo package for more information about the crash
Created attachment 79129 [details] Added debuginfo for most of the information that I could decode debug packages installed: at-spi-debuginfo-1.7.14-1.fc7.i386.rpm glibc-debuginfo-2.5.90-14.i686.rpm glibc-debuginfo-common-2.5.90-14.i386.rpm gnome-games-debuginfo-2.17.4.1-2.fc7.i386.rpm guile-debuginfo-1.8.1-1.fc7.i386.rpm kernel-debuginfo-2.6.19-1.2891.fc7.i686.rpm kernel-debuginfo-common-2.6.19-1.2891.fc7.i686.rpm libgnomeui-debuginfo-2.17.0-1.fc7.i386.rpm ORBit2-debuginfo-2.14.4-1.fc7.i386.rpm
System: Linux 2.6.19-1.2891.fc7 #1 SMP Thu Dec 21 10:59:07 EST 2006 i686 X Vendor: The X.Org Foundation X Vendor Release: 70101000 Selinux: No Accessibility: Enabled Memory status: size: 56164352 vsize: 0 resident: 56164352 share: 0 rss: 24498176 rss_rlim: 0 CPU usage: start_time: 1167620985 rtime: 0 utime: 805 stime: 0 cutime:648 cstime: 0 timeout: 157 it_real_value: 0 frequency: 0 Backtrace was generated from '/usr/libexec/aisleriot' Using host libthread_db library "/lib/libthread_db.so.1". [Thread debugging using libthread_db enabled] [New Thread -1208191280 (LWP 3254)] 0x00da3402 in __kernel_vsyscall ()
+ Trace 98400
Thread 1 (Thread -1208191280 (LWP 3254))
----------- .xsession-errors (9 sec old) --------------------- (Gecko:3104): GLib-GObject-CRITICAL **: g_signal_emit_valist: assertion `signal_id > 0' failed GTK Accessibility Module initialized Bonobo accessibility support initialized GTK Accessibility Module initialized Bonobo accessibility support initialized Some deprecated features have been used. Set the environment variable GUILE_WARN_DEPRECATED to "detailed" and rerun the program to get more information. Set it to "no" to suppress this message. GTK Accessibility Module initialized Bonobo accessibility support initialized GTK Accessibility Module initialized Bonobo accessibility support initialized /usr/libexec/aisleriot: No such file or directory. -----------------------------------------------
Hello... Looking at the backtrace, the crash doesn't seem to be caused by aisleriot, but instead by guile. I will definitively need some help debugging this crash.
Thanks for the diagnosis. I have not experienced any noticeable failures with other aspects of the system. Presently, I have the below version of guile installed. guile-1.8.0-8.20060831cvs I'll help with clear explanation to run any diagnosis.
correction on version of guile. I was in FC6 which does not have the problem. Development currently has guile-1.8.1-1.fc7 Will change component on downstream bug for guile component.
many packages updated but still getting a dump when quiting application. System: Linux 2.6.19-1.2904.fc7 #0 SMP Tue Jan 2 00:25:46 EST 2007 i686 X Vendor: The X.Org Foundation X Vendor Release: 70101000 Selinux: No Accessibility: Enabled Memory status: size: 55877632 vsize: 0 resident: 55877632 share: 0 rss: 24358912 rss_rlim: 0 CPU usage: start_time: 1168095954 rtime: 0 utime: 1836 stime: 0 cutime:1419 cstime: 0 timeout: 417 it_real_value: 0 frequency: 0 Backtrace was generated from '/usr/libexec/aisleriot' Using host libthread_db library "/lib/libthread_db.so.1". [Thread debugging using libthread_db enabled] [New Thread -1208785200 (LWP 3064)] 0x00f04402 in __kernel_vsyscall ()
+ Trace 99887
Thread 1 (Thread -1208785200 (LWP 3064))
----------- .xsession-errors (7 sec old) --------------------- Bonobo accessibility support initialized Unable to connect to yum-updatesd. Please ensure that the yum-updatesd package is installed and that the service is running. Unable to connect to yum-updatesd. Please ensure that the yum-updatesd package is installed and that the service is running. Some deprecated features have been used. Set the environment variable GUILE_WARN_DEPRECATED to "detailed" and rerun the program to get more information. Set it to "no" to suppress this message. GTK Accessibility Module initialized Bonobo accessibility support initialized GTK Accessibility Module initialized Bonobo accessibility support initialized /usr/libexec/aisleriot: No such file or directory. -------------------------------------------------
I downgraded at-spi and played the game and won. With the older version at-spi-1.7.11-2.fc6 installed, quiting the application does not launch bug buddy. The game just closes.
This means that the bug is in at-spi? Would it be OK for me to close this bug then?
Closing the bug would be fine. Unless you see any information in the data provided which would lead to a more secure program exit. I could not reproduce problem without a broken at-spi again.
This bug is being reassigned to the "general" component so we can close the aisleriot bugzilla component. Apologies for the mass email!